How much does it cost to rent an apartment in MidCentral?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| MidCentral Studio Apartments | $1,880 | $1,641 | $2,167 |
| MidCentral 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,178 | $1,390 | $2,990 |
| MidCentral 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,527 | $2,095 | $3,874 |
| MidCentral 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,305 | $2,534 | $5,174 |

Frequently Asked Questions about MidCentral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in MidCentral?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in MidCentral with Washer/Dryer is at Arabelle City Center listed at $1,641.
How much is the average rent for MidCentral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in MidCentral with Washer/Dryer is $3,020.
What is the largest MidCentral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in MidCentral is a 1,771 square feet unit starting from $2,148 at City Center on 7th.
What is the average size for MidCentral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in MidCentral is currently at 748 sq ft.
